应用故障定位实战:提升系统维护效率

随着信息技术的飞速发展,企业对于系统稳定性和维护效率的要求越来越高。在众多问题中,应用故障定位成为了一项至关重要的技能。本文将从实战角度出发,探讨如何提升系统维护效率,确保企业业务的正常运行。

一、应用故障定位的重要性

  1. 降低维护成本:快速定位故障原因,减少排查时间,降低人力成本。

  2. 提高系统稳定性:及时发现并解决潜在问题,确保系统稳定运行。

  3. 提升客户满意度:缩短故障修复时间,提高客户满意度。

  4. 优化资源配置:合理分配维护资源,提高资源利用率。

二、应用故障定位实战技巧

  1. 确定故障现象

首先,需要了解故障现象,包括故障发生的时间、地点、涉及的业务模块等。通过收集这些信息,可以初步判断故障的可能原因。


  1. 收集日志信息

日志是系统运行过程中记录的详细信息,通过分析日志可以了解故障发生时的系统状态。以下是几种常见的日志类型:

(1)系统日志:记录系统运行过程中的错误、警告等信息。

(2)数据库日志:记录数据库操作过程中的错误、警告等信息。

(3)网络日志:记录网络通信过程中的错误、警告等信息。


  1. 分析故障原因

根据日志信息,结合故障现象,分析故障原因。以下是一些常见的故障原因:

(1)代码错误:程序逻辑错误、数据类型不匹配等。

(2)硬件故障:服务器、网络设备等硬件故障。

(3)配置错误:系统配置参数错误、网络配置错误等。


  1. 制定修复方案

根据故障原因,制定相应的修复方案。以下是一些常见的修复方法:

(1)代码修复:修改程序逻辑,修复错误。

(2)硬件更换:更换故障硬件设备。

(3)配置调整:修改系统配置参数,调整网络配置。


  1. 验证修复效果

修复故障后,进行测试验证,确保问题已解决。以下是一些测试方法:

(1)功能测试:验证修复后的功能是否正常。

(2)性能测试:评估系统性能是否达到预期。

(3)压力测试:模拟高并发场景,检测系统稳定性。


  1. 总结经验教训

故障定位过程中,总结经验教训,为今后类似问题提供参考。以下是一些经验教训:

(1)加强日志管理:确保日志信息完整、准确。

(2)优化系统架构:提高系统可维护性。

(3)提高团队协作能力:加强团队沟通,提高故障响应速度。

三、提升系统维护效率的策略

  1. 建立完善的故障处理流程

明确故障处理流程,包括故障报告、分析、修复、验证等环节,确保故障处理高效、有序。


  1. 培养专业人才

加强技术培训,提高团队成员的故障定位能力,培养一批具备实战经验的系统维护人才。


  1. 优化工具和技术

引入先进的故障定位工具和技术,提高故障排查效率。


  1. 强化预防措施

定期进行系统检查,发现潜在问题,提前采取措施,预防故障发生。


  1. 持续改进

不断总结经验教训,优化故障处理流程,提高系统维护效率。

总之,应用故障定位是系统维护工作中的关键环节。通过实战技巧和提升策略,可以有效地提升系统维护效率,确保企业业务的稳定运行。

猜你喜欢:全栈链路追踪